Highly discreet Retained Medical Specialist needed for UHNW maritime operations. £240k GBP tax-free, autonomous Mediterranean role.

An ultra-high-net-worth (UHNW) principal requires the permanent, full-time expertise of a highly discreet sole medical practitioner. This critical appointment centers on providing preventative and acute healthcare management within a strictly private, secure floating estate. Operating with total clinical autonomy, you will be trusted to uphold hospital-grade standards of care in a highly confidential environment.

The principal's travel itinerary encompasses the most exclusive jurisdictions across the Mediterranean. You will be directly responsible for the medical readiness of the client as they transition seamlessly between private anchorages in Italy, Monaco, the Algarve, the Greek Islands, Mallorca, Marbella, and Ibiza. This assignment is specifically designed for a confident clinical leader who prioritizes independent decision-making, flawless discretion, and bespoke patient management over heavily bureaucratic healthcare systems.



Requirements

  • Academic Origin: The chosen candidate will possess a verified medical doctorate originating from the UK, Ireland, Australasia (New Zealand/Australia), North America (USA/Canada), or Europe.

  • Professional Experience: We demand at least 5+ years of robust, post-specialty clinical tenure.

  • Specialist Knowledge: Your foundational clinical expertise must lie in Family Medicine, Emergency Care, or Internal Medicine.

  • Communication Protocol: Absolute fluency in spoken and written English is a non-negotiable requirement for this highly sensitive post.



Benefits

  • Compensation Structure: A secure, permanent contract offering £240,000 GBP per year, completely tax-exempt.

  • Liability & Health Cover: The employer fully funds comprehensive malpractice indemnification and elite-tier private medical insurance.

  • Accommodation & Transit: Dedicated private housing is supplied onboard, and all professional travel costs are entirely absorbed by the principal.

  • Leave & Admin: Entitlement to 30 days of paid annual leave, accompanied by seamless, end-to-end visa application assistance.
